Job Summary

SUMMARY:

Under general supervision and according to the established policies and procedures, conducts quality assurance audits, space inspections, shop inspections, mechanical space inspections, room and area inspections and department evaluations.

Incumbent is guided by thorough knowledge of computer software system for quality program, word processing, data management, supervision, and basic building system knowledge.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Plans, organizes, and controls functions of computerized Quality Assurance programs in maintenance operation.
  • Prepare, set-up system, and maintain computerized Quality Assurance program and schedule all inspections, audits and evaluations as per established matrix.
  • Conduct all inspections, audits, and evaluations as per the established matrix. Investigate all complaints regarding quality issues.
  • Operates and maintains Cleantelligent software system and all other data, hardware software systems related to the departments operation.
  • Support performance improvement and safety activities.
  • Audit, research, gather data and prepare reports on quality assurance and day-to-day operations.

Performs a variety of duties:

  • Responds to emergencies at the facility as directed.
  • Submits ideas on continuous quality improvement.
  • Takes minutes and participates in committees as required.
  • Must be able to drive a motorized vehicle on a daily basis
  • Performs related and other department duties as required.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Associates Degree in an Engineering or Business Field, and 5 years’ of experience in the maintenance field with a demonstrated skill in one trade and a good understanding of other trades through work experience at similar institutions, or;
  • High School Diploma/GED and 10 years’ experience in the maintenance field, with a demonstrated skill in one trade and a significant understanding of other trades acquired through work experience at similar institution/s, and;
  • The ability to read, comprehend and transmit complicated detailed instructions in writing and orally.
  • Effective written (spelling/grammar) skills, computer proficient (Microsoft Office, specifically proficiency in Excel & Word etc.) Database management, accounting, and knowledge of various office equipment/systems.
